The cheapest way to get from Leyte to Palawan is to ferry via Manila which costs ₱4,600 - ₱8,500 and takes 2 days 8h.
The fastest way to get from Leyte to Palawan is to taxi and fly which takes 4h 58m and costs ₱10,000 - ₱15,000.
No, there is no direct ferry from Leyte to Palawan. However, there are services departing from Naval and arriving at Puerto Princesa via Cebu and Iloilo.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 2 days 5h.
The distance between Leyte and Palawan is 792 km.
The best way to get from Leyte to Palawan without a car is to ferry which takes 2 days 5h and costs ₱5,000 - ₱12,000.
It takes approximately 4h 58m to get from Leyte to Palawan, including transfers.
